Transaction 4357ef82633b5207c44e6bf2cd056d8e603c25967e37695a9149fc025c61bca9

3 Input
2 Outputs
  • 4357ef82633b5207c44e6bf2cd056d8e603c25967e37695a9149fc025c61bca9:0
  • value  961268
    address  3BfQUW9PMTL9hCYUdua1QKAMTiaEDGuiTY
  • 4357ef82633b5207c44e6bf2cd056d8e603c25967e37695a9149fc025c61bca9:1
  • value  5000000
    address  37iEpTphoAQJHuu9BpYnTCs79QEv6cSRpr